No need at this point to pull the heads. Just pull the valve covers and check the pushrods on the injectors. If one is bent it will be loose. One stuck injector holds al the racks to zero on these motors, as opposed to the runaway situation you get with other jimmys.

To operate the high idle, you have to have the truck running and in neutral, and flip the switch beside the PTO knob. That will kick it in to 1200 rpm. If you shift the tranny, or turn of the master, the rpm will drop back down to idle.

For fuel line just use hydraulic hose with reusable fittings. That will outlast you. Just check as not all hydraulic hose is recommended for diesel. But if you go to a hose place, you won't be the first guy to go there looking for this purpose.
